PDF de programación - Guía de administración de Debian GNU/Linux

Imágen de pdf Guía de administración de Debian GNU/Linux

Guía de administración de Debian GNU/Linuxgráfica de visualizaciones

Actualizado el 27 de Febrero del 2021 (Publicado el 2 de Junio del 2018)
550 visualizaciones desde el 2 de Junio del 2018
195,4 KB
71 paginas
Creado hace 21a (03/07/2002)
Guía de administración de Debian

GNU/Linux

Jorge Juan Chico <[email protected]>

Manuel J. Bellido Díaz <[email protected]>

Versión 0.4 (3 julio 2002)

Resumen

Este documento es una guía de introducción a la administración de Debian GNU/Linux, correspondiente
a la versión 3.0 (woody) de la distribución.

Nota de Copyright
Copyright c2001 los Autores
Este manual es software libre; puedes redistribuirlo y/o modificarlo bajo los términos de Licencia Gen-
eral de GNU, publicada por la Free Software Foundation; ya sea la versión 2 o (a tu opinión) cualquier
versión posterior.

Índice General

1

Introducción

2 Arranque y parada del sistema

2.1 El gestor de arranque lilo .

2.2 Proceso init y runlevels

2.3 Parada del sistema .

.

.

.

.

.

.

.

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.

.

. . . . . . . . . . .

. .

. .

. .

. .

. .

. .

. .

. .

. .

. .

3 Sistema de ficheros

i

1

3

4

8

9

11

3.1 Estructura del sistema de ficheros . . . . . . . . . . .

. .

. .

. .

. .

. .

. .

. .

. .

. .

. 11

3.2 Ficheros especiales .

.

.

3.2.1 Enlaces “duros” .

.

.

.

.

. . . . . . . . . . . . . .

. .

. .

. .

. .

. .

. .

. .

. .

. . 14

. . . . . . . . . . . . . . . . .

. .

. .

. .

. .

. .

. .

. .

. 14

3.2.2 Enlaces “simbólicos” .

. . . . . . . . . . . . . . .

. .

. .

. .

. .

. .

. .

. .

. . 14

3.2.3

Ficheros de dispositivo . . . . . . . . . . . . . . .

. .

. .

. .

. .

. .

. .

. .

. . 15

3.2.4 Tuberías (fifo’s) .

.

.

. . . . . . . . . . . . . . . . .

. .

. .

. .

. .

. .

. .

. .

. 16

3.3 Administracion del sistema de ficheros . . . . . . . . .

. .

. .

. .

. .

. .

. .

. .

. .

. . 16

3.3.1 Montar y desmontar dispositivos.

. . . . . . . . . .

. .

. .

. .

. .

. .

. .

. .

. 16

3.3.2

Fichero /etc/fstab .

.

.

. . . . . . . . . . . . . . .

. .

. .

. .

. .

. .

. .

. .

. . 18

3.3.3 Distribuyendo el sistema de ficheros a través de varias particiones .

. .

. .

. .

. 18

3.3.4

Sistemas de ficheros avanzados

. . . . . . . . . . . .

. .

. .

. .

. .

. .

. .

. . 24

3.4 Manipulación de diskettes

.

. . . . . . . . . . . . . .

. .

. .

. .

. .

. .

. .

. .

. .

. . 26

3.4.1 Manipular diskettes como en MS–DOS: mtools . . .

. .

. .

. .

. .

. .

. .

. .

. 26

3.4.2

Formatear diskettes .

. . . . . . . . . . . . . . . . . .

. .

. .

. .

. .

. .

. .

. . 27

3.4.3 Manipulación de diskettes a bajo nivel . . . . . . . .

. .

. .

. .

. .

. .

. .

. .

. 28

ÍNDICE GENERAL

4 Gestión de usuarios y grupos

ii

31

4.1 Añadir usuarios y grupos .

.

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 31

4.2 Eliminar usuarios y grupos .

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 32

4.3 Modificar usuarios y grupos

.

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 32

4.4 Ficheros relacionados con la gestión de usuarios y grupos . . . . . . . . . . . . . . . . . 33

4.5 Algunos grupos especiales

4.6 Límites a los usuarios .

.

.

.

.

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 33

.

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 34

4.6.1 Ejemplos de limites horarios . . . . . . . . . . . . . . . . . . . . . . . . . . . . 35

4.7 Limites de quotas .

. .

.

.

.

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 36

4.7.1 Administrando el sistema de quotas . . . . . . . . . . . . . . . . . . . . . . . . 36

5 Manipulación de paquetes Debian

39

5.1 Manipulación de paquetes a alto nivel

. . . . . . . . . . . . . . . . . . . . . . . . . . . 39

5.1.1 Dselect

.

. .

. .

. .

5.1.2 APT .

. .

. .

. .

. .

.

.

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 39

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 40

5.2 Reconfiguración de paquetes instalados

. . . . . . . . . . . . . . . . . . . . . . . . . . 43

5.3 Manipulación de paquetes a bajo nivel

. . . . . . . . . . . . . . . . . . . . . . . . . . . 44

5.4 Obtención y compilación de paquetes fuente Debian . . . . . . . . . . . . . . . . . . . . 45

6 Españolización de Linux

47

6.1 Configuracion del teclado para el modo texto (consola)

. . . . . . . . . . . . . . . . . . 47

6.2 Localización .

.

.

.

.

.

.

.

.

.

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 48

7 Configuración de la hora

51

7.1 Ver la hora actual del sistema .

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 51

7.2 Cambiar la hora .

.

.

.

.

.

.

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 51

7.3 Escribir la hora en el reloj hardware . . . . . . . . . . . . . . . . . . . . . . . . . . . . 52

7.4 Establecer la hora desde el reloj hardware . . . . . . . . . . . . . . . . . . . . . . . . . 52

7.5 Establcer y mantener la hora desde un servidor de hora . . . . . . . . . . . . . . . . . . 53

7.6 Cambiando la zona horaria .

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 53

ÍNDICE GENERAL

8 Configuración de la impresora

iii

55

8.1 Soporte en el kernel para puerto paralelo . . . . . . . . . . . . . . . . . . . . . . . . . . 55

8.2 Servidor de impresión y utilidades de control. Sistema tradicional

. . . . . . . . . . . . 56

8.3 Filtros de impresión .

.

.

.

.

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 56

8.4 Gestión de colas de impresión. Comando BSD.

. . . . . . . . . . . . . . . . . . . . . . 57

8.5 Refinar/modificar la configuración .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 58

8.6 Common Unix Printing System (CUPS) . . . . . . . . . . . . . . . . . . . . . . . . . . 58

8.6.1

Instalación de CUPS .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 58

8.6.2 Configuración/gestión de impresoras . . . . . . . . . . . . . . . . . . . . . . . . 59

8.6.3 Configuración del servidor CUPS . . . . . . . . . . . . . . . . . . . . . . . . . 60

8.7

Información adicional sobre impresión . . . . . . . . . . . . . . . . . . . . . . . . . . . 60

9

Instalando nuevos modulos y compilando un nuevo Kernel

61

9.1

Instalando nuevos modulos .

.

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 61

9.1.1 Ejemplo de instalación del módulo de la tarjeta de sonido SB128PCI . . . . . . . 61

9.2 Compilando un nuevo kernel

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 63

9.2.1 Obteniendo y desempaquetando los fuentes . . . . . . . . . . . . . . . . . . . . 63

9.2.2 Configurando el kernel .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 63

9.2.3 Compilando el kernel .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 64

9.2.4

Instalando el nuevo kernel

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. 65

9.2.5 Compilando e instalando los nuevos módulos del kernel

. . . . . . . . . . . . . 65

ÍNDICE GENERAL

iv

1

Capítulo 1

Introducción

Este documento pretende ser una guía concisa para la administración básica de un sistema Debian
GNU/Linux. Está enfocada a la resolución de los aspectos más frecuentes relacionados con la admin-
istración del sistema. Con esta guía, un usuario debe ser capaz de configurar el sistema que mejor se
adapte a sus necesidades, de mantener en funcionamiento su sistema Debian y de localizar información
más detallada en la documentación que se incluye con el propio sistema.

Se supone que el lector está familiarizado con los comandos básicos de UNIX/Linux, o al menos que es
capaz de “moverse” por el sistema de ficheros y de editar ficheros de texto.

Salvo el apartado dedicado al gestor de arranque lilo, y que es específico de la plataforma i386, el resto
debe ser aplicable a cualquier plataforma soportada por Debian.

Capítulo 1. Introducción

2

3

Capítulo 2

Arranque y parada del sistema

El arranque de un sistema Linux consta de las siguientes fases:

• Ejecución del gestor de arranque (p.ej. lilo)
• Carga y ejecución del kernel
• Ejecución de init (proceso número 1)
• Ejecución de scripts de iniciación genéricos en /etc/rcS.d
• Entrada en el runlevel por defecto: ejecución de scripts del runlevel en /etc/rcX.d, donde X

el el número del runlevel.

A grandes rasgos el proceso ocurre así: al conectar o reiniciar el ordenador, la BIOS busca en su configu-
ración el dispositivo de arranque por defecto, el cual suele ser un disco duro, indicado generalmente en la
configuración de la BIOS por C. Entonces carga en memoria el primer sector del dispositivo de arranque
y le transfiere el control. Cuando se trata de un disco duro, este primer sector es el Master Boot Record
(MBR) y contiene, además del código cargado por la BIOS, la tabla de particiones del disco. El código
en el MBR, generalmente, lee en la tabla de particiones cual es la partición activa y carga en memoria
el primer sector de la misma, transfiriéndole el control. En nuestro caso, este sector estará ocupado por
un gestor de arranque (en adelante supondremos que es lilo) que nos permitirá arrancar Linux u otro
sistema operativo. Opcionalmente, puede instalarse lilo en el MBR, tomando antes el control.

Una vez cargado lilo, éste se ejecuta, busca el kernel de Linux en una posición conocida del disco, carga
el kernel en memoria y le cede el control. El kernel se almacena comprimido en disco, por lo que lo
primero que hace el código del kernel que se ejecuta inicialmente es descomprimir el propio kernel y
situarlo en memoria. Entonces se ejecuta realmente el kernel y empieza una lista de comprobaciones
y activación de módulos internos del mismo. Una vez funcionando, el kernel monta el disco principal
donde se almacena el sistema operativo (root filesystem y ejecuta el primer proceso: init. La misión de
init es ejecutar el resto de procesos del sistema: comprobación de discos, detección/configuración de
hardware adicional, apertura de terminales, servidores, etc.

En las siguientes
  • Links de descarga
http://lwp-l.com/pdf11547

Comentarios de: Guía de administración de Debian GNU/Linux (0)


No hay comentarios
 

Comentar...

Nombre
Correo (no se visualiza en la web)
Valoración
Comentarios...
CerrarCerrar
CerrarCerrar
Cerrar

Tienes que ser un usuario registrado para poder insertar imágenes, archivos y/o videos.

Puedes registrarte o validarte desde aquí.

Codigo
Negrita
Subrayado
Tachado
Cursiva
Insertar enlace
Imagen externa
Emoticon
Tabular
Centrar
Titulo
Linea
Disminuir
Aumentar
Vista preliminar
sonreir
dientes
lengua
guiño
enfadado
confundido
llorar
avergonzado
sorprendido
triste
sol
estrella
jarra
camara
taza de cafe
email
beso
bombilla
amor
mal
bien
Es necesario revisar y aceptar las políticas de privacidad